Biography
Osceola Alston is a part of US Black heritage.
Osceola Alston was born in Clarke County, Alabama.
TEC4 Osceola Alston served in the United States Army in World War II Service started: 16 Nov 1942 Unit(s): Co. F, 389th Engineers Service ended: 7 Sep 1945
Osceola was born in 1907.
In the 1910 census Oscar (age 3) was the son of James Austin in Clarksville, Clarke, Alabama, United States.[1]

In the 1920 census Oceola (age 11) was the son of Sarah Austin in Clarkesville, Clarke, Alabama.[2]

In the 1940 census Osceola (age 32), Farm Laborer, was the single son of James M Abston in Clarkesville, Clarke, Alabama.[3]

Osceola married on 10 September 1945 in Clarke, Alabama.[4]
